What Does a Car Accident Attorney Do?

Car accident lawyers perform a lot of work on each case. They review documents like pictures and witness statements. They also call health professionals to request medical records.

They know the laws of their state which govern car accidents. They can assist you in filing an insurance claim or lawsuit to ensure your complete financial recovery.

Experience

A reputable lawyer for car accidents will be well-versed in the laws and procedures pertaining to a personal injury case. They know what questions to ask, what evidence is admissible, and how to best present the evidence before a juror. This will save you a lot of time and effort trying to figure this out on your own.

Depending on the circumstances of your accident, it may be necessary to file a lawsuit in order to recover damages from the at-fault party. Your lawyer can handle the paperwork and communicate with defense attorneys on your behalf and allow you to concentrate on healing.

They will take a thorough look at the accident and all of your medical records to determine how the crash impacted your life. They will also visit the site of the accident to take notes and gather evidence. They will then use all of the information to create an argument for the amount of compensation you are entitled to.

Damages include future medical bills, loss of earning potential due to your injuries, as well as suffering and pain. A seasoned lawyer in car accidents will be able to calculate your losses and assign an amount of money on them. Your lawyer will fight for every cent you're due.

Car accident lawyers are highly trained and have years of experience in handling car accidents and the claims that result from them. They can quickly evaluate your case and provide the most accurate advice on the amount your claim is worth. If you try to settle the claim by yourself you are likely to find that you'll get less than you are due.

In certain instances it is possible for multiple parties to be held accountable for the accident and injuries. This includes other motorists or drivers who caused the collision, and also the car manufacturer if there was an issue with the manufacturing process of one or more of the car's parts. Your attorney can help you identify any potential responsible parties and pursue the right claims against them.

Knowledge of the Law

justice-lawyers-businesswoman-in-suit-or-lawyer-w-2023-05-09-21-23-20-utc-scaled.jpgThe job of a car accident lawyer is to ensure that their client is fair compensated in the event of a collision. This includes lost wages, medical expenses, as well as suffering and pain. They will also be aware of the laws that govern auto accidents, as well as time limits (called statutes of limitations) that can bar a lawsuit if not filed within a specific period of time following an accident.

Most accident injury attorneys are paid on a contingency fee basis. This means that they only get paid if the case is successfully concluded. This means that they are obligated to do everything they can to secure the best settlement possible.

As part of their preparation, accident attorneys will review all relevant documentation such as police reports, witness statements and the insurance policy, including PIP coverage, liability coverage, medical payments and u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age. They may also collaborate with outside experts, such as accident lawyer near me reconstruction experts or medical professionals, to build the strongest possible case.

Accident attorney lawyers will also be aware of the ways in which road conditions, for example that can lead to an accident. These are referred to as roadway defect cases, and can include such things as improper roadway design, inadequate road maintenance or construction and debris that could lead to an accident.
